Early anthropologists, following the theory that words determine
thought, believed that language and its structure were entirely dependent on
the cultural context in which they existed. This was a logical extension of
that is termed the Standard Social Science Model, which views the human(1)______
mind like a structure capable of absorbing any sort of culture without(2)______
constraints from genetic or neurological factors. In this vein, anthropologist
Verne Ray conducted a study in the 1950’s, giving color samples to different
American Indian tribes and asking them to give the names of the colors. He
concluded that the spectrum we see it as "green", "yellow", etc.(3)______
were an entirely arbitrary division, and each culture divided the spectrum(4)______
separately. According to this hypothesis, the divisions seen between colors
are a consequence of the language we learn, and do not correspond to
divisions in the natural world. A similar hypothesis is upheld in the extreme(5)______
popular study of Eskimo words for snow—common stories vary from fifty to
upward of two hundred. Extreme cultural relativism of this type has now(6)______
been clearly refuting. Eskimos use at most twelve different words for snow,(7)______
which is not much more than English speakers and should be expected since(8)______
they exist in a cold climate. The color-relativity hypothesis has now been
completely replaced by more careful, thorough, and systematic studies
which show a remarkable similarity between the ways which different(9)______
cultures divide the spectrum. Of course, there are ways in which culture
really does determine language, or at least certain facets thereof.
Obviously, the ancient Romans did not have the words for radios,(10)______
televisions, or computers because these items were simply not part of their
cultural context.
